Comment (by vorner):

 This is the desired behaviour I believe. This is how the thing reacts to
 not being able to close previous sockets/give them up to boss. If we
 ignored the error, the system would end up in an inconsistent state, so we
 terminate here. The problem with msgq is a separate issue. OK to close as
 invalid?
